Synopsis

Fedhealth's new 3rd Edition was expanded 44 pages to accommodate many new topics and enhancements. Two key additions include 24 new pages in the TERRORISM topic covering cyber, biological, chemical and radiological threats with tips on what citizens should be aware of during these types of incidents. Also, APPENDIX A - U.S. Department of Homeland Security was expanded to include the District of Columbia Emergency Management Agency’s "Terrorist Threat Advisory System" with suggestions for Residents and Businesses. (In other words, each color-code now has many tips on what family members and business owners should be aware of and doing at each threat level - along with standard list of what federal agencies should be doing at each color.)

The entire manual was reorganized so the information flows easier for consumers. Section 1 now has all Family information, checklists, Emergency Plan templates, and suggestions for Kits (both Disaster Kits to "grab and go" during a disaster situation and First Aid Kits). Section 2 now contains all disaster topics (from Avalanches to Winter Storms) but all BEFORE tips are 2-color format like DURING and AFTER tips in previous Editions. Some other additions include Air Quality Mitigation (i.e. tips on carbon monoxide, mold & radon), Household Chemical emergencies, Safford-Simpson Scale with storm surge data (for hurricanes), Fujita Scale (for tornadoes), plus many others. Section 3 has all Basic First Aid tips now (from Bites & Stings to Strokes) along with some new topics like West Nile, ticks, and SARs. Section 4 still contains American and Canadian Red Cross information plus U.S. and Canadian Federal, Provincial, and State Emergency Contact information for citizens. There are also many new "Additional Resources & Web sites" with some specific ones flagged for Educators, Schools, & Kids. The more the public is prepared for a disaster, the less strain it places on North American First Responders. This manual helps families and individuals "be aware… be prepared… and have a plan" for most types of emergencies, first aid needs, and natural or man-made disasters before they strike. It provides an excellent easy-to-use resource for all family members… from children to seniors.
